Comprehending New Zealand’s Online Gambling Laws
In New Zealand, the rules for gambling are set by the Gambling Act 2003. This law establishes a unique scenario for online play. It stops New Zealand-based companies from providing online casino games here without a license. But crucially, it does not make it a crime for individual players to use overseas gambling sites. This nuance is key. As an individual living in New Zealand, you are allowed to sign up and play at offshore casinos like Yoyo Casino. The main stipulation is that the casino itself must hold a valid license from a recognized regulatory body. The legal responsibility is on the operator to comply with its license rules, not on you for simply putting a bet.
Reliability of Games and RNG Accreditation
You have to be able to trust the games. Yoyo Casino gets its games from major software studios like NetEnt, Pragmatic Play, and Evolution Gaming. These companies are leaders, and their games are frequently checked for fairness by independent auditors. The core of a fair game is its Random Number Generator (RNG). A certified RNG ensures that every card dealt, every slot spin, and every dice throw is completely random. The casino can’t rig it, and neither can you. Trusted developers transparently show certificates from testing agencies like e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or GLI, which proves their games are on the level.
Safe Betting Tools and Assistance
A casino that values safety offers players ways to manage their gambling. Yoyo Casino provides tools to help you stay in control. Inside your account, you can typically set limits on how much you deposit, lose, or bet, and how long you can play. For a more serious break, self-exclusion options are offered too. The site should also link to professional help organizations. In New Zealand, the main service is run by the Department of Internal Affairs. They offer a free, confidential helpline and website, and can refer people to in-person counselling for gambling harm.
